**Segmenting Your Audience: The Key to Effective Campaigns**
Before launching any SMS campaign, it’s vital to segment your audience. Generic messages rarely resonate. Different customer groups have different needs, preferences, and behaviors. Think about demographics, purchase history, engagement levels, and even past interactions with your brand. For example, a loyalty program could send exclusive offers to members, while a new customer could receive a welcome message and introductory discount. Using data to segment your audience allows you to tailor your messaging for maximum impact. A well-defined segmentation strategy ensures that your campaigns are relevant and engaging. This targeted approach dramatically increases the likelihood of conversions. Utilizing CRM systems to gather and analyze customer data is a cornerstone of effective segmentation.

**High-Performing SMS Campaign Examples**
Here are a few examples of successful SMS marketing campaigns:
* **Retailer Promotion:** A clothing retailer sends a text message offering a 15% discount on a specific item to customers who have previously purchased from them. This leverages their existing purchase history.
* **Restaurant Loyalty:** A restaurant sends a text message to its loyalty program members announcing a special offer on their favorite dishes. This encourages repeat visits.
* **Travel Company Deals:** A travel company sends a text message with a discount code for flights or hotels to customers who have booked a trip. This is a timely and effective way to drive bookings.
* **Subscription Service Reminder:** A streaming service sends a reminder text message to subscribers about upcoming episodes. This keeps them engaged with the service.
These examples demonstrate the power of SMS to drive engagement and conversions. The key is to offer value and make it easy for customers to respond.

**Best Practices for SMS Marketing Success**
* **Compliance:** Always adhere to SMS marketing regulations, including obtaining consent before sending messages and providing an easy opt-out option.
* **Personalization:** Go beyond generic greetings. Tailor messages to individual customer preferences and behaviors.
* **Timing:** Send messages at optimal times when your audience is most likely to be receptive.
* **Clear Call to Action:** Include a clear and concise call to action in your messages.
* **Mobile Optimization:** Ensure your messages are easily readable on mobile devices.
